Algeria: Understanding Debt and Loans

Algeria is a North African country with a rich history and diverse culture. As with many nations around the world, Algeria has had to grapple with the complexities of managing its debt and loans to ensure economic stability and growth. In this blog post, we will delve into the definitions and concepts related to debt and loans in the context of Algeria. Debt can be broadly defined as the amount of money that a country or entity owes to others. In the case of Algeria, the country has incurred both internal and external debt through borrowing from various sources such as international financial institutions, foreign governments, and domestic lenders. Managing this debt is crucial for Algeria to maintain its economic health and avoid defaulting on its financial obligations. Loans, on the other hand, refer to the money borrowed by Algeria that must be repaid over a specified period of time, usually with interest. Loans can be used to finance various projects and initiatives aimed at boosting economic development, such as infrastructure projects, social programs, and investments in key sectors like energy and agriculture. In recent years, Algeria has faced challenges in managing its debt and loans, particularly in the face of economic downturns and fluctuating global market conditions. The government has had to implement measures to reduce debt levels, such as austerity measures, fiscal reforms, and seeking financial assistance from international institutions like the International Monetary Fund (IMF). Despite these challenges, Algeria remains committed to addressing its debt issues and fostering sustainable economic growth. The country has taken steps to diversify its economy, attract foreign investment, and improve its fiscal management practices to reduce reliance on borrowing and strengthen its financial position.
